OBD-II

OBD-II vehicle diagnostics are performed by using sensors that detect problems with vehicles. Sensors send abnormal data to the vehicle's engine control unit (ECU), which stores it as a Diagnostic Trouble Code (DTC). This code is a string containing numbers and letters, which indicates the nature and origin of the problem. OBD-II codes are used to identify all areas of a vehicle including the chassis, powertrain and network.

OBD-II diagnostics for vehicles can be carried out using a variety of tools. These tools can vary from simple tools for consumers to advanced OEM dealership tools and vehicle Telematic systems. Hand-held scanners and fault code readers are the most basic tools. However, there are also high-end and robust tools available in the market.

A scanner tool is a device that can read the diagnostic trouble codes of the vehicle's computer system. It can also read the vehicle's VIN. OBD-II scanners have a feature that can read codes from any protocol. The data can be read and processed by mechanics and give you the necessary information about your vehicle's problem.

OBD-II vehicle diagnostics can help you save money on repairs and boost your car's performance. They can also provide information regarding the health and condition of engine components as well as emission control. With this information, a technician can identify issues quickly and quickly.

CANBUS

If you own a CANBUS compliant vehicle, you can do an entire system scan with an instrument for scanning. This will allow you to see which modules need to be on and which are off. This could indicate a problem with the wiring or communication.

Many symptoms are caused by CAN bus errors This includes the complete or partial loss of vehicle functionality. These faults can often cause an audible warning or visual warning for the driver. Other signs could include software malfunctions. A CAN bus issue could cause a malfunctioning charging system, low battery voltage, or improper connections.

Low resistance readings at CAN ports are an indication of a faulty wiring harness or CAN. Some CAN devices may contain an internal termination resistor which switches between on and off when the device starts up. The service information provided by the manufacturer should contain the internal termination resistors used for the specific CAN device.

The CAN bus protocol, which is a message-based protocol, allows components of automobiles to communicate with one another. In addition to providing communication between vehicles, it also allows for the reduction of copper by using multiplex electrical wiring. Each device transmits data in a frame, which is then received by all devices in the network.

Check engine light

A Check engine light on your vehicle could indicate a serious problem. You should immediately take your vehicle to a mechanic if you notice an red or orange light. It will cost less to fix it the faster you take action. This light could also be accompanied by other symptoms, for instance, an abnormal engine noise.

No matter the reason regardless of the cause, the Check Engine Light is meant to alert you to an issue in your vehicle. This engine-shaped orange icon is typically found in the instrument cluster, and it comes on when the car's computer detects the presence of a problem. This indicator can be triggered by a range of issues however, sometimes it's as simple as a gas cap that isn't tight enough or a malfunctioning spark plug.

Another reason for the Check Engine Light is a issue with the exhaust system. A valve for the recirculation of exhaust gas (EGR) can cause this light to turn on. Although these valves don't require regular maintenance, they do be clogged with carbon and will require replaced. EGR valves that are not working properly can also cause higher levels of emissions. After you have resolved the issue your car will automatically turn off the light. If your mobile car diagnostics's CEL remains on for longer than three days, you may want to check it again, or manually reset the light.

A diagnostic scan will reveal what codes are causing your Check Engine light to come on. Sometimes an easy scan with the basic scan tool can uncover the root of the issue. A professional scanner is required for more complicated issues.

Trouble-shooting diagnostics

DTCs (diagnostic trouble codes) are codes that can be used to identify problems with your vehicle. They range in length between one and five characters and could represent anything from an indicator light to a malfunctioning engine. These codes can be used to troubleshoot and identifying the root of the problem.

Although DTCs are used to diagnose issues with vehicles, not all of them are serious. In some cases, the trouble codes suggest that the sensor circuit is out of range, or there is a malfunction in the emissions control system. Once you've pinpointed the source of the issue then you can begin to figure out the solution. It is crucial to determine the location where trouble codes are stored in your vehicle. DTCs are usually stored in the Engine Control Module or Powertrain Control Module.

It is also essential to identify the root of the issue by using diagnostic trouble codes. These codes can be used to assist a mechanic in diagnosing the issue and determine the most effective option for action. For instance the check engine light may signal a problem in the fuel level sensor circuit system. It could also be a sign of an issue with the emissions idle control system. Sometimes, the flash may indicate something more serious such as gas caps that are not in place.

Checking the air filter

Filters that are dirty could cause a variety of problems in your car, such as jolting acceleration, unburnt fuel as well as mini explosions. Examining the air filter will help you spot the problems early and you could even spot them before your car shows any symptoms. Begin by removing all fasteners that join the air intake box together. These fasteners could be clipsor screws or even hex nuts. After the fasteners have been removed it is possible to remove the air filter.

Make sure the filter is properly placed and cleaned. This will enable the filter to carry out its tasks effectively. If the filter is not clean the engine won't operate properly and could not give you a reliable reading. The air filter is close to the engine or near to the front of your vehicle.

A blocked air filter may cause the check engine light to flash. This indicator could also indicate an issue that is more serious. A blocked air filter could cause too much fuel to be burned , hindering the flow of air into your engine. Carbon deposits that are excessive can cause the check engine light to flash. A qualified mechanic will be able identify the cause of the light's appearance.

Cleaning the air filter is a crucial part of the engine of a car. It keeps dust and dirt out of the engine's atmosphere and results in a smoother combustion. If the airflow is not properly maintained the engine will have problems starting, running or increasing.
